[For FTX models]

 

„

Using the indoor unit ON/OFF switch 

Press the indoor unit ON/OFF switch for at least 5 seconds. (The operation will start.) 

•  Forced cooling operation will stop automatically after about 15 minutes. 

To stop the operation, press the indoor unit ON/OFF switch.

Trial Operation and Testing

•  When trial operation is conducted directly after the circuit breaker is turned on, in some cases no air will be output for about 15 

minutes in order to protect the air conditioner.

1. 

Trial operation and testing

Refer to the installation manual for the indoor unit.

2. 

Test items

Test items

Symptom

Check

Indoor and outdoor units are installed securely.

Fall, vibration, noise

No refrigerant gas leaks.

Incomplete cooling/heating function

Refrigerant gas and liquid pipes and indoor drain hose extension are 

thermally insulated.

Water leakage

Draining line is properly installed.

Water leakage

System is properly grounded.

Electrical leakage

The specified wires are used for inter-unit wiring.

No operation or burn damage

Indoor or outdoor unit’s air inlet or air outlet are unobstructed.

Incomplete cooling/heating function

Stop valves are opened.

Incomplete cooling/heating function

Indoor unit properly receives remote control commands.

No operation
